worksheets on a tablet with a stylus. It follows the same structured method as traditional paper Kumon but provides immediate digital submission and real-time instructor feedback. Kumon India Quick Setup Guide Kumon Connect correctly, follow these technical steps: Web-Based Access:
It is not a standard app store download. You must open your tablet's recommended browser ( for iOS or Google Chrome
for Android) and navigate to the URL provided by your instructor. Add to Home Screen:
To use it as an application, click the "Share" or "Menu" button in your browser and select "Add to Home Screen" Device Compatibility: Ensure your tablet is compatible (e.g., 7th–10th Gen or Samsung Galaxy Tab S6 Lite ) and that your OS is updated to the latest version. Initial Login: Use the Student ID and temporary password provided by your Kumon Centre
. You will be prompted to set a new password upon first login. www.kumon.ie Proper Usage Tips for Students Focus Mode:
Close all other apps before starting to prevent memory errors and distractions. Stylus Requirement:
Use a compatible stylus to maintain the cognitive benefits of handwriting. Submission Routine: kumon app.digital.kumon
Completed worksheets are submitted automatically once finished. If the app is offline, you cannot log out until the data is sent. Daily Study:
Assignments are ready each day. If a day is missed, the work automatically shifts to the next time you log in. Math and Reading Worksheets on Your Tablet - Kumon

3. Instructor Dashboard (The "Behind the Scenes" Feature)
- What it does: From
app.digital.kumon, instructors can see:- Timelapse replay: They watch the student’s actual writing sequence (did they erase 5 times? hesitate before a step?).
- Time per problem: Identifies exactly where a student slows down.
- Why it matters: In a physical center, an instructor sees the final answer. Here, they see the problem-solving process, allowing targeted coaching on timing or careless errors.
5. Offline Mode + Sync
- What it does: Students can download 10+ days of assignments. Work completed offline automatically syncs when Wi-Fi returns.
- Why it matters: Perfect for car rides, travel, or areas with poor connectivity—no disruption to the daily Kumon habit.
